摘要
In this paper, a statistical approach has been applied to determine the influence of inverter drive parameters on the rate and the amplitude of flashover currents in bearings of AC motors. The main cause of bearing currents is a charge accumulated on the shaft as a result of temporarily electric asymmetry at the output of the inverter in a presence of parasitic capacitive couplings inside the motor. The proposed statistical method could be the basis for comparative analyses of bearing damage hazard in a various drive configurations. (c) 2005 Elsevier B.V. All rights reserved.
